CVE-2026-64497

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: iio: chemical: scd30: Cleanup initializations and fix sign-extension bug Include linux/bitfield.h for FIELD_GET(). Create new macros for bit manipulation in combination with manual bit manipulation being replaced with FIELD_GET(). The current variable declaration and initializations are barely readable and use comma separations across multiple lines. Refactor the initializations so that mantissa and exp have separate declarations and sign gets initialized later. In addition (and due to the nature of the cleanup), fix a sign-extension bug where, float32 would get bitwise anded with ~BIT(31) (which is 0xFFFFFFFF7FFFFFFF) which corrupted the exponent.
